Sandhills Horticultural Gardens

A serene oasis located in the heart of the Sandhills region, these gardens provide a vibrant display of diverse plant species and cultivated landscapes. Visitors can explore themed areas including the butterfly garden and a variety of annual and perennial beds. Walking paths meander through the grounds, showcasing seasonal beauty and offering ideal spots for photography or quiet reflection.

The gardens also serve as an educational resource, hosting workshops and events that enhance knowledge about horticulture and sustainable gardening practices. Families and plant enthusiasts alike will enjoy periodic events celebrating local flora and fauna. Ample seating allows guests to relax and appreciate the tranquility that this green space offers.

The North Carolina Zoo

Located just a short drive from Carthage, The North Carolina Zoo offers visitors a unique opportunity to explore a vast array of wildlife in a natural setting. Home to over 1,600 animals representing more than 250 species, the zoo is designed to mimic the natural habitats of its residents. Visitors can wander through the expansive grounds, which feature exhibits themed around North America and Africa, allowing for an immersive experience in diverse ecosystems.

In addition to the impressive collection of animals, the zoo prioritizes conservation and education. The facility hosts various programs and workshops aimed at promoting awareness about wildlife preservation and environmental stewardship. Families will enjoy interactive exhibits as well as the chance to attend special events throughout the year, making it a great destination for those looking to learn more about animals while enjoying a day outdoors.

Carthage Farmers Market

The Carthage Farmers Market is a vibrant hub for both locals and visitors. Open on Saturdays, it showcases fresh produce, homemade goods, and unique crafts from local vendors. The atmosphere is welcoming, with community members often engaging in friendly conversations while browsing the various stalls. Seasonal fruits and vegetables reflect the region's agricultural richness, making it an ideal spot for those seeking quality ingredients.

In addition to produce, the market features a variety of local artisans. Shoppers can find handmade soaps, baked goods, and handcrafted items that add character to their homes. This market not only supports local farmers and businesses but also fosters a sense of community. Participating in the market allows visitors to experience the local culture and enjoy the fruits of the region's labor.
